About Sacred Heart College
Just over an hour from Melbourne’s CBD, Sacred Heart College is located in the heart of Geelong, offering the perfect blend of rewarding work and coastal lifestyle.
A Catholic secondary school for girls with a proud Mercy tradition, Sacred Heart is known for its inclusive, values-driven culture and strong sense of community. Our College promotes excellence, curiosity, creativity, and personal growth through our strategic vision, Strategy 2021 and Beyond. You can read more about our strategy in the attached document.
Whether you're considering a sea change or seeking a role that aligns with your values, Sacred Heart is a place where you can do meaningful work with lasting impact.
